Output e8626f3c15629420141325b8bb7ed5a82ff97eacad52cedac25b5465241fd079:84

value
70373
script pubkey
OP_0 OP_PUSHBYTES_20 bd4cfa4493d752deffcb2297378e63f55869c372
address
bc1qh4x053yn6afdal7ty2tn0rnr74vxnsmjuxd5ze
transaction
e8626f3c15629420141325b8bb7ed5a82ff97eacad52cedac25b5465241fd079